		     | 目的 探讨基质窖蛋白1(Cav-1)、乳酸脱氢酶B(LDH-B)和丙酮酸激酶2(PKM2)在人肺腺癌(PAC)组织中的表达并分析3者的相关性及其临床意义。方法 采用量子点免疫荧光组织化学(QDs-IHC)技术检测68例PAC组织和16例非癌性肺组织中基质Cav-1、LDH-B和PKM2的表达情况。结果基质Cav-1在PAC组织的阳性率为58.8%,与非癌变肺组织的阳性率100%相比,差异有统计学意义(P<0.05)。肺腺癌组织中LDH-B和PKM2的阳性率分别为76.5%、70.6%,均高于非癌性肺组织(均P<0.05)。PAC中、低分化组PKM2的阳性率均高于高分化组(均P<0.05)。结论基质Cav-1缺失,LDH-B、PKM2的高表达可能促进PAC的恶性进展。 |

                | Expression  of  stromal  caveolin-1,  LDH-B  and  PKM2  in  pulmonary  adenocarcinoma |

                | Abstract: | 
			
                | Objective To investigate the expression of  stromal  caveolin-1  (Cav-1),  L-lactate  dehydrogenase  B (LDH-B) and pyruvate kinase M2 (PKM2) in pulmonary adenocarcinoma (PAC) tissues. Methods The expression of stromal Cav-1, LDH-B and PKM2 proteins in 68 specimens of PAC and 16 specimens of noncancerous lung tissue with quantum dots immunofluorescent histochemistry(QDs-IHC), Results The positive rates of stromal Cav-1 in PAC tissues and non-cancerous lung tissues were 58.8% and 100.0%(P<0.05). The positive rates of LDH-B and PKM2 expression in PAC tissues were 76.5% and 70.6%, respectively, which were higher than those in noncancerous lung tissues(P<0.05). The expression of PKM2 in mid-
dle/low-differentiated PAC was higher than that in well-differentiated PAC(P<0.05).    Conclusion    The results indicated that stro- mal Cav-1 is down-regulated and LDH-B and PKM2 are up-regulated in pulmonary adenocarcinoma. |
